| Manufacturer | Allen Bradley |
|---|---|
| Product Type | Adjustable Frequency AC Drive |
| Product Line | PowerFlex 700S |
| Part Number | 20DJ385N0NNNBCNNN |
| Weight | 32.00 lbs (14.51 kg) |
| Voltage | 650V DC |
| Phases | 3 |
| 650V Input Amps | 385 |
| Enclosure | Open/IP00 |
| Human Interface Machine | Blank Cover |
| Documentation | No |
| Brake | No |
| Bus Undervoltage Trip | Adjustable |
| Heat Sink Thermistor | Monitored by microprocessor overtemp trip |
| Logic Control Ride-Thru | 0.25 sec., drive not running |
| Power Ride-Thru | 15 milliseconds at full load |
The PowerFlex 700S series features the 20DJ385N0NNNBCNNN adjustable frequency AC drive, which is engineered to handle demanding industrial tasks. This drive is designed to operate with a voltage input of 650V DC, providing the necessary power for high-performance applications. It has an impressive normal-duty current rating of 385 amps, easily accommodating substantial electrical loads.
The drive is housed in an open enclosure rated at IP00, ensuring basic protection suitable for controlled environments. A notable design aspect of this unit is its blank cover for the human interface machine option, and it does not include a built-in documentation package.
Safety and reliability are key characteristics of this drive. It features an adjustable bus undervoltage trip, allowing customization per operational requirements. A heat sink thermistor is integrated and continuously monitored by a microprocessor, which activates an overtemperature trip if the heat exceeds safe levels.
When the drive is not actively running, it maintains logic control for up to 0.25 seconds, ensuring stability in the face of temporary power interruptions. Additionally, it can sustain performance under full load for up to 15 milliseconds during power outages, highlighting its resilience during critical operations.
